EBU Calls for European Legislation “With Teeth” to Protect PSB Prominence Against Big Tech Gatekeepers
Much has changed since the last time the Audiovisual Media Services Directive (AVMSD), the EU's legal framework that coordinates national legislation for audiovisual services, was revised back in 2018. With video content now accessed through a range of different entry points, public service media (PSM) content sits alongside all types of video, all competing for Read More
